
Chinese Dairy Imports Update – Sep ’19
Executive Summary
Chinese dairy import figures provided by IHS Markit were recently updated with values spanning through Aug ‘19. Highlights from the updated report include:
Aug ’19 Chinese Dairy Import Volumes Declined 2.1% MOM but Remained up 4.1% YOY
Aug ’19 Total Chinese Dairy Imports Reached a Record High Seasonal Level
Aug ’19 Chinese WMP Import Volumes Declined 12.0% MOM and 12.6% YOY
Aug ’19 Chinese WMP Imports Remained at the Third Highest Seasonal Level on Record
Aug ’19 Chinese SMP Import Volumes Declined 8.2% MOM but Remained up 38.4% YOY
Aug ’19 Chinese SMP Imports Reached a Record High Seasonal Level
Aug ’19 Chinese Dairy Imports Excluding WMP & SMP Increased 2.2% MOM and 3.6% YOY
Aug ’19 Chinese Dairy ‘Other’ Imports Reached a Record High Seasonal Level
New Zealand and the EU-28 Each Accounted for Over a Third of all Aug ’19 Chinese Imports
Aug ’19 New Zealand & U.S. Shares of Total Chinese Dairy Imports Declined YOY
Aug ’19 EU-28 Share of Total Chinese Dairy Imports Increased Most Significantly YOY
- Aug ’19 Chinese dairy import volumes increased on a YOY basis for the tenth time in the past 11 months, finishing up 4.1% to a record high seasonal level for the month of August.
- Aug ’19 Chinese whole milk powder imports declined on a YOY basis for the first time in the past 11 months, finishing down 12.6% but remaining at the third highest seasonal level on record. Aug ’19 Chinese skim milk powder imports increased 38.4% YOY to a record high seasonal level, however, while Aug ’19 Chinese dairy imports excluding whole milk powder and skim milk powder increased 3.6% YOY, also reaching a record high seasonal level.
- Aug ’19 Chinese dairy imports originating from within the EU-28 continued to gain market share from the previous year, while the New Zealand and U.S. market shares finished below previous year levels.
